Abstract: L'invention concerne un circuit oscillateur à commande de phase automatique qui produit un signal d'horloge de sortie dont la phase et la fréquence varient avec celles d'un signal d'information d'entrée qui lui est appliqué Le cicuit comprend une borne d'entrée 64 recevant le signal d'information, un circuit d'accord 63 connecté à la borne d'entrée de façon à laisser passer le signal d'information d'entrée sous forme de signal accordé, et un générateur de signaux d'horloge connecté au circuit d'accord. Le circuit d'accord est un circuit à fréquence variable dont un dispositif d'entrée reçoit ledit signal d'information d'entrée, et dont un circuit d'entrée de commande reçoit un signal de commande Cv représentatif de la fréquence du signal d'information d'entrée Din, le circuit d'accord étant accordé sur la base du signal de commande de façon à laisser passer le signal d'information sous forme de signal accordé depuis une de ses sorties. Il est également prévu une boucle de correction de phase 70 66 afin de compenser les déphasages introduits par le circuit d'accord. L'invention s'applique notamment aux magnétoscopes numériques.

Abstract: A voice processing device for determining a prediction value of a voice of high sound quality by extracting a prediction tap for predicting a prediction value of a voice of high sound quality from a synthesized voice produced by imparting a linear prediction coefficient determined from a predetermined code and a residual signal to a speech synthesizing filter and by performing a predetermined calculation by using the prediction tap and a predetermined tap coefficient, comprising a prediction tap extracting section (45) for extracting from a synthesized voice a prediction tap used for predicting a voice of interest of high sound quality for which a prediction value is to be determined, a class tap extracting section (46) for extracting a class tap used for categorizing the voice of interest into one of class from a code, a categorizing section (47) for categorizing the voice of interest into a classes on the basis of the class tap, a tap creating section for acquiring a tap coefficient corresponding to the class of the voice of interest from tap coefficients of the respective classes determined by learning, and a prediction section (49) for determining a prediction value of the voice of interest by using the prediction tap and the tap coefficient corresponding to the class of the voice of interest.

Abstract: A device and method for encoding an image into hierarchical codes. The compression efficiency of the encoding is improved and deterioration of image quality is reduced. Image data are encoded using regressive hierarchical expression and dividing adaptively blocks according to the natures of the data. The encoded hierarchical data obtained by the division are transmitted. Thus, blocks of lower hierarchies can be divided and, as a result, the quantity of information about flat portions of an image can be reduced.

Abstract: A device and method for encoding an image into hierarchical codes. Since the quantizing step width of lower hierarchical data having a higher resolution than that of higher hierarchical data is determined, on the basis of the quantizing step widths determined for the higher hierarchical data having a lower resolution, for every prescribed block of hierarchical data, additional codes indicating the characteristics of quantizers can be eliminated. Therefore the compression efficiency at the time of encoding can be improved and the deterioration of image quality can be reduced.

Abstract: A difference signal generated in a prediction encoding process is block-segmented by a block segmenting circuit 2. Thus, the level distribution of the block-segmented difference signal is concentrated to a narrower portion than the level distribution of one entire screen. Reference values DR and MIN of each block of the difference signal are detected. A quantizing step width DELTA and shift data DELTA S are determined corresponding to such reference values and the number of quantizing bits N. A quantizing circuit 6 quantizes the difference signal with DELTA . The difference signal is shifted and quantized so that the level 0 of the difference signal is obtained as 0 on the decoding side. A flag FLG and DELTA that represent the quantized value of the level 0 are transmitted as side information along with the quantized value Q.

Abstract: A technique for enhancing the quality of speech decoded by a linear predictive decoder, wherein decoded prediction coefficients defining synthesis filter coefficients are obtained. Preset coefficients derived by learning are acquired and used to carry out predictive calculation on the decoded prediction coefficients to obtain predicted values to be used by the synthesis filter. The technique involves learning the preset coefficients using a teacher signal and minimizing a prediction error.

Abstract: A subtraction device subtracts a predicted value generated by a predicting portion from a digital picture signal supplied through an input terminal. The subtraction device generates a difference signal as an output signal. A quantizing portion detects an activity of the difference signal, designates the number of quantizing steps corresponding to the activity, and quantizes the difference signal with the number of quantizing steps. The quantizing portion outputs side information to an output terminal.
